Protest the Hero is a Canadian progressive metal/mathcore band from Whitby, Ontario. Formed in 1999, the members have maintained the same lineup since their inception. Initially called Happy Go Lucky, they changed their name before the release of their first EP, *A Calculated Use of Sound*, followed by their debut full-length album, *Kezia*, released by the independent label Underground Operations. On January 23, 2006, the band officially signed with Vagrant Records for the US release of *Kezia*, which was released in the US on April 4, 2006. Their second full-length album, *Fortress*, was officially released by Underground Operations in Canada and by Vagrant Records worldwide on January 29, 2008. The band is known for its complex and virtuosic music, which combines elements of progressive metal, mathcore, and post-hardcore. Their lyrics often explore philosophical, existential, and social themes.
